Understanding the Importance of Sustainable Swordfish Industry
The swordfish industry, known for its high demand and significant economic impact, faces critical challenges related to sustainability. Overfishing, bycatch, and habitat destruction have raised concerns among environmentalists, policymakers, and industry stakeholders. The need for sustainable practices is paramount to ensure the long-term viability of swordfish populations and the ecosystems they inhabit.
